Clarence Sports Facilities - Community needs survey


Clarence City Council is developing the Clarence Sports Facilities Strategic Plan and invites feedback from the community via our survey. We want to hear from you about participation in organised sports and as well as your needs and ideas for future investment in our facilities. This feedback will be used to inform the development of a long-term visionary plan.

The Sports Facilities Strategic Plan will provide an overarching sports facility planning framework for the City of Clarence. The 20-year Strategic Plan will:

  • Identify the current and future needs for certain (primary) sporting facilities in the City of Clarence.
  • Guide sports facility planning and development for the City of Clarence, including future capital works funding, asset management and financial planning related to sporting facilities will be based.

The Strategic Plan will focus on the following major participation sports:

  • Australian Rules football (AFL)
  • Cricket
  • Football (Soccer)
  • Basketball
  • Netball

The plan will also examine other sports within Clarence whose current and future facilities impact those planned or are required for the above sports, including:

  • Tennis
  • Lawn Bowls
  • Croquet
  • Gymnastics
  • Little Athletics
  • Touch football
  • and more...

Council has engaged Otium Planning Group (Sport and Leisure Planning Consultancy) to prepare the Plan.
